The Black Russian is a timeless cocktail created in 1949 by bartender Gustave Tops at the Hotel Metropole in Brussels. The drink combines vodka and coffee liqueur for a simple but powerful flavor profile. It is perfect as an evening drink and an excellent choice for those who appreciate clean flavors with a hint of sweetness and bitterness.

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 50 ml vodka
  • 20 ml coffee liqueur (e.g. Kahlúa)
  • Ice cubes

Instructions

  1. Fill an old-fashioned glass with ice cubes.
  2. Pour in the vodka and coffee liqueur.
  3. Stir gently to mix the ingredients.
  4. Serve immediately.

Pro tips

  • Use a quality vodka for the best taste.
  • Adjust the amount of coffee liqueur to adjust the sweetness to taste.
  • Serve with a high-quality ice cube to avoid watering down the drink.
